PD#138714: vout: add tvout mode monitor for box

add sysfs node /sys/class/display/mode_flag,
change mode_flag to 0 to stop monitor tvout mode.

/* ***************************************************** */
/* hdmi/cvbs output mode monitor */
/* ***************************************************** */
static int refresh_tvout_mode(void)
{
enum vmode_e cur_vmode = VMODE_MAX;
char *cur_mode_str;
int hdp_state = 0;
if (tvout_monitor_flag == 0)
return 0;
#ifdef CONFIG_AMLOGIC_HDMITX
hdp_state = get_hpd_state();
#endif
if (hdp_state) {
cur_vmode = validate_vmode(hdmimode);
cur_mode_str = hdmimode;
} else {
cur_vmode = validate_vmode(cvbsmode);
cur_mode_str = cvbsmode;
}
if (cur_vmode >= VMODE_MAX) {
VOUTERR("%s: no matched cur_mode: %s\n",
__func__, cur_mode_str);
return -1;
}
/* not box platform */
if ((cur_vmode != VMODE_HDMI) && (cur_vmode != VMODE_CVBS))
return -1;
if (cur_vmode != last_vmode) {
VOUTPR("%s: mode chang\n", __func__);
if (set_vout_mode(cur_mode_str) == 0)
strcpy(vout_mode, cur_mode_str);
last_vmode = cur_vmode;
}
return 0;
}
static void aml_tvout_mode_work(struct work_struct *work)
{
mutex_lock(&tvout_mode_lock);
refresh_tvout_mode();
mutex_unlock(&tvout_mode_lock);
if (tvout_monitor_flag)
schedule_delayed_work(&tvout_mode_work, 1*HZ/2);
}
static void aml_tvout_mode_monitor(void)
{
if ((vout_init_vmode != VMODE_HDMI) && (vout_init_vmode != VMODE_CVBS))
return;
VOUTPR("%s\n", __func__);
last_vmode = vout_init_vmode;
tvout_monitor_flag = 1;
INIT_DELAYED_WORK(&tvout_mode_work, aml_tvout_mode_work);
mutex_lock(&tvout_mode_lock);
refresh_tvout_mode();
mutex_unlock(&tvout_mode_lock);
schedule_delayed_work(&tvout_mode_work, 1*HZ/2);
}
